With slightly more young women than men going to university, female students are dominating in an increasing number of fields, figures from national statistics agency CBS show.

For example, 81% of students studying veterinary science are female, as are 65% of law students and 58% of biochemistry and biology students.

Men outstrip the number of women studying humanities, architecture and business administration and account for over 80% of transport and logistics, computer science and technology students.
